读取csv文件(代码片段)

smileblogs smileblogs     2023-04-03     185

关键词:

<!--csv-->
        <dependency>
            <groupId>net.sourceforge.javacsv</groupId>
            <artifactId>javacsv</artifactId>
            <version>2.0</version>
        </dependency>
Map<String, CoordinateDto> map = new HashMap<>();

    @PostConstruct
    private Map <String, CoordinateDto> generatorCoordinate() throws Exception 
        log.info("读取结算单填充坐标点 xy.csv");
        Resource resource = new ClassPathResource("xy.csv");
        InputStream inputStream = resource.getInputStream();
        CsvReader csvReader = new CsvReader(inputStream, Charset.forName("utf-8"));
        csvReader.readHeaders(); //跳过第一行标题行
        while (csvReader.readRecord()) 
            String row = csvReader.getRawRecord(); //读取一整行数据
            String[] arr = row.split(",");
            map.put(arr[0], new CoordinateDto(Integer.parseInt(arr[1]), Integer.parseInt(arr[2])));
        
        return map;
    

 

python读取mat文件-转csv文件(代码片段)

这篇教程主要介绍如何使用Python读取mat文件并且转csv文件。一、读取mat文件和转CSV首先将MATLAB生成的mat文件存储在一个目录下importpandasaspdimportscipyfromscipyimportioimportos#遍历文件夹fordirname,_,filenamesinos.walk('./data'):forfilenameinfile... 查看详情

python读取/写入csv文件的列表。(代码片段)

查看详情

python读取/写入csv文件的列表。(代码片段)

查看详情

php用php读取csv文件(代码片段)

查看详情

python读取csv文件并添加索引(代码片段)

...的数据操作,这里我们使用pandas库中的read_csv()函数,在读取csv数据的同时可以对其添加行索引和列索引。importpandasaspdobj=pd.read_csv(‘testdata.csv‘)print(obj)read_csv()不对属性进行设置的缺省状态下,对于csv文件进行读取操作后,即使... 查看详情

4_3读取csv文件(代码片段)

 1"""读取csv文件"""234importcsv56defreadcsv_demo1():7"""采用列表形式,下标操作"""8withopen(‘csvwriter.csv‘,‘r‘)asfp:9#reader是一个迭代器10reader=csv.reader(fp)11next(reader)#向下走一行12forxinreader:13#print(x)14name=x[1] 查看详情

python-简单方便的读取csv文件(代码片段)

本文提供一个简易读取CSV的函数,方便后续处理。使用pandas库,读取csv文件获取csv的列名遍历csv每一行,组成字典输出读取进度,避免长时间等待。返回列名,和每一行的字典源码如下:defread_csv_file(data_fi... 查看详情

csharp在c#中读取csv文件(代码片段)

查看详情

读取txt文件,生成csv文件(代码片段)

最近做了个小程序,要求在同文件夹下的txt文件,处理内容之后,生成csv文件。1importjava.io.*;2importjava.util.ArrayList;3importjava.util.List;45publicclassSimplify67publicstaticvoidmain(String[]args)89List<String>resultList=readT 查看详情

pandasread_csv读取大文件的memoryerror问题(代码片段)

今天在读取一个超大csv文件的时候,遇到困难:首先使用office打不开然后在python中使用基本的pandas.read_csv打开文件时:MemoryError最后查阅read_csv文档发现可以分块读取。read_csv中有个参数chunksize,通过指定一个chunksize分块大小来读取文... 查看详情

一个简易的php读取csv文件的方法(代码片段)

1.思路:先打开文件,读取出文件有多少行,然后逐行读取数据放入一个数组中publicfunctionread_csv_lines($csv_file=‘‘,$lines=0,$offset=0)if(!$fp=fopen($csv_file,‘r‘))returnfalse;$i=$j=0;while(false!==($line=fgets($fp)))if($i++<$offse 查看详情

同时读取几个.csv文件[重复](代码片段)

...nebylinesimultaneously3回答我试图通过两个不同的.csv文件循环读取值。打开一个.csv文件时,我能够完美地运行程序;但是,当我导入第二个.csv文件时,我收到如下错误:回溯(最近一次调用最后一次):文件“C:UserscrteeicDesktopProject... 查看详情

python-pandas读取mongodb读取csv文件(代码片段)

...m/lutt/p/10810581.html本篇的内容是将存储到mongo的数据用pandas读取出来,存到CSV文件,然后pandas读取CSV文件。其中mongo的操作涉及到授权的问题:如果遇到报错关于authenticate的,需要加授权 查看详情

scala如何读取csv文件(代码片段)

...且查询总总跳转到spark相关的内容,这里记录一下scala读取csv文件的操作过程(未找到合适的依赖库,自己实现同样简单)。代码实现需要注意自己需要知道csv文件有几列,然后再使用split方法将其划分成两个... 查看详情

scala如何读取csv文件(代码片段)

...且查询总总跳转到spark相关的内容,这里记录一下scala读取csv文件的操作过程(未找到合适的依赖库,自己实现同样简单)。代码实现需要注意自己需要知道csv文件有几列,然后再使用split方法将其划分成两个... 查看详情

读取csv文件(代码片段)

@Data@Builder//构造器publicclassCtripCommentReviewIdprivateStringreviewId; publicclassCtripCommentCleanByFileTaskpublicstaticfinalStringfile_path="/home/q/commondata/ctrip/";publicstaticfinalStringWRAPPER_ID="CtripImport";@AutowiredprivateCrawlerReviewDetailDaocrawlerReviewDetailDao;@Autowir... 查看详情

python读取csv文件中的某一列(代码片段)

比如这样的一个csv文件:想要读取imageID和label注:imageID的第一个数据是:000858e87c40654aimportpandasaspdpath='yourfile.csv'#使用pandas读入data=pd.read_csv(path)#读取文件中所有数据#按列分离数据x=data[[ 查看详情

python读取csv文件做dbscan分析(代码片段)

1.读取csv数据做dbscan分析读取csv文件中相应的列,然后进行转化,处理为本算法需要的格式,然后进行dbscan运算,目前公开的代码也比较多,本文根据公开代码修改,具体代码如下:fromsklearnimportdatasetsi... 查看详情